Drawings
FIG. 1 is a schematic structural view of a leather cushion embossing device for a motorcycle;
FIG. 2 is a schematic structural view of a flat plate in an embossing device for a motorcycle leather seat cushion;
FIG. 3 is a schematic structural view of a top plate in the leather cushion embossing device for a motorcycle;
fig. 4 is a schematic structural view of a rotary rod in the leather cushion embossing device for a motorcycle.
In the figure: 1. a flat plate; 2. a frame; 3. pressing a plate; 4. a spring; 5. a top plate; 6. a box body; 7. a fan blade; 8. a heat pipe; 9. rotating the rod; 10. a first tube; 11. a second tube; 12. a fixed block; 13. a limiting rod; 14. a nut; 15. a through hole; 16. a first motor; 17. a second motor; 18. a third motor; 19. a material collecting box.
Detailed Description
Referring to fig. 1 to 4, in an embodiment of the present invention, a leather cushion embossing device for motorcycles includes a plate 1 and a frame 2, the frame 2 is disposed on one side of the plate 1, a pressing plate 3 is vertically slidably disposed on a lower end of the frame 2, a spring 4 and a top plate 5 are disposed on an upper end of the plate 1, a lower end of the top plate 5 is fixedly connected to an upper end of the spring 4, a box 6 is disposed on a lower side of the plate 1, a fan blade 7 is rotatably disposed inside the box 6, a heat pipe 8 is disposed on an upper end of the box 6, a rotating rod 9 is rotatably disposed on one side of the frame 2, a first pipe 10 is fixedly disposed on an upper end of the plate 1, a second pipe 11 is disposed on an outer side of the first pipe 10, the second pipe 11 is disposed between a lower end of the top plate 5 and an outer side position of the spring 4, a fixing block 12 is horizontally fixedly disposed on one end of the second pipe 11, a through hole 15 is disposed on a surface of the fixing block 12 and the plate 1, the limiting rod 13 is arranged in the through hole 15, the second pipe 11 is connected with the flat plate 1 through the through hole 15 and the limiting rod 13, the nut 14 is arranged at the lower end of the limiting rod 13, a cushion to be embossed is placed at the upper end of the top plate 5, the pressing plate 3 at the lower end of the frame 2 moves downwards, so that the pattern below the pressing plate 3 can be pressed on the upper surface of the cushion, the pressure can be uniformly distributed due to the plurality of springs 4 arranged at the lower end of the top plate 5, thus when the pattern is pressed, force can be uniformly applied to the surface of a material, cracking of the surface of the material due to instantaneous overlarge impact force can not occur, the quality during pressing is improved, the limiting effect is simultaneously carried out on the second pipe 11 and the flat plate 1 through the limiting rod 13, the position deviation of the springs 4 can not occur during pressing, and the connection mode is simple due to the threaded connection mode, the disassembly and the assembly are more convenient.
The inside of the box body 6 is fixedly provided with a first motor 16, the fan blade 7 is rotatably arranged at the output end of the first motor 16, one end of the frame 2 is fixedly provided with a second motor 17, the output end of the second motor 17 is rotatably provided with a third motor 18, the rotating rod 9 is rotatably arranged at the output end of the third motor 18, one side of the flat plate 1 is provided with a material collecting box 19, the upper end of the material collecting box 19 is lower than the top plate 5, the heat pipe 8 generates heat and raises the temperature, when the first motor 16 drives the fan blade 7 to rotate, the fan blade 7 blows wind power, the wind blows the heat generated by the heat pipe 8 to the upper end, thereby raising the temperature of the leather cushion at the upper end, so that the material becomes soft, in winter, because the temperature is lower, the material can be fractured by sudden pressing, thereby raising the temperature and improving the product yield, when the second motor 17 rotates, make second motor 17 drive the third motor 18 of upper end rotate, drive dwang 9 when third motor 18 rotates, when dwang 9 rotates, make dwang 9 drive the material of roof 5 upper end and remove, after the suppression is accomplished, make dwang 9 drive the inside that the material fell to case 19 that gathers materials, thereby realize automatic operation of gathering materials, need not the manual collection of operating personnel, reduced operating personnel's intensity of labour.
The utility model discloses a theory of operation is: the cushion to be embossed is placed at the upper end of the top plate 5, the pressing plate 3 at the lower end of the frame 2 moves downwards, so that the pattern below the pressing plate 3 can be pressed on the upper surface of the cushion, and the pressure can be uniformly distributed due to the arrangement of the plurality of springs 4 at the lower end of the top plate 5, so that when the pattern is pressed, force can be uniformly applied on the surface of the material, the surface of the material is not cracked due to instantaneous excessive impact force, and the quality during pressing is improved, because the limiting rod 13 simultaneously performs the limiting effect on the second pipe 11 and the flat plate 1, the springs 4 cannot be shifted during pressing, and meanwhile, the threaded connection mode enables the connection mode to be simple, the disassembly and the assembly are convenient, the heat pipe 8 generates heat, the temperature is raised, when the first motor 16 drives the fan blades 7 to rotate, make flabellum 7 blow off wind-force, wind blows to the upper end with the heat that heat pipe 8 produced, thereby make the leather cushion temperature of upper end rise, make the material become soft some, in winter, because the temperature is lower, sudden suppression can make the material fracture appear, thereby the heating up has improved the yields of product, when second motor 17 rotates, make second motor 17 drive third motor 18 of upper end rotate, drive dwang 9 rotates when third motor 18 rotates, when dwang 9 rotates, make dwang 9 drive the material of roof 5 upper end and remove, after the suppression is accomplished, make dwang 9 drive the inside that the material fell to case 19 that gathers materials, thereby realize automatic operation of gathering materials, need not the manual material of operating personnel, operating personnel's intensity of labour has been reduced.
